    The Kansas City Chiefs and the New York Giants will face off in the Week 8 edition of Monday Night Football. Kickoff in Kansas City is set for 8:15 p.m. ET. The Chiefs are favored by 10.5 points in the latest Giants vs. Chiefs odds from Caesars Sportsbook, while the over-under is 52.

    New York can take solace in Kansas City's defensive weaknesses. The Chiefs are dead-last in yards allowed per drive (40.8) and points allowed per drive (2.87) this season. Kansas City is also a bottom-five team in third down defense, total defense, scoring defense and rushing defense. Giants quarterback Daniel Jones is playing his best football and leads the team in rushing.

    Kansas City remains dynamic offensively. Even with a sub-.500 record, the Chiefs land in the top quartile of the league in points, yards, points per drive, first downs, completions, touchdowns and yards per carry, among others. Kansas City is the best team in the league in yards per drive (44.4), and the Chiefs convert a league-leading 57 percent of their third down attempts.
